Text

Action on the attorney's bond or to recover against a deposit made in lieu of the bond may be brought at any time by one or more subscribers suffering loss through a violation of its conditions or by the Commissioner as liquidator of the insurer. Amounts recovered on the bond shall be deposited in and become part of the insurer's funds. The total aggregate liability of the surety shall be limited to the amount of the penalty of the bond.
